. . "Cars 1 made ???only??? 47.2% of its $462M internationally, so Pixar/Disney decided to rev up the sequel???s foreign appeal by sending its vehicles on a race to Tokyo, Italy, London and Paris after the studio found that the tow truck resonated with kids around the world. (The Japanese washlet toilet scene is sight to behold.) Cars 2 is opening in 18 international markets including Italy, Russia, Br" . .